Output 85e16f2db028acddb3f73cbea33550a563b93832502431036b9ec1651b7eef1c:1

value
15363812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9842811aa80bf9f4e332879a1d908d350f0f577 OP_EQUAL
address
3QSLVhsWP892ihf3xD9Hb92WaFTgyb8MFa
transaction
85e16f2db028acddb3f73cbea33550a563b93832502431036b9ec1651b7eef1c
spent
true